      General Contractor will not complete punch-list items. It has been eight months since GC was paid final payment upon receipt of Temporary Certificate of Occupancy and seven months since permanent CoO issued. Owner of WGO, *********************** will not respond to email or text. Will not answer phone nor return calls as requested during voicemails and by email.These items still remain unaddress and no one has been in contact to discuss repairs/installation.The following have not be completed/repaired as noted.-Steel strap/angle above doors/windows on brick walls have not been addressed. All are rusting.-Paint/mortar on concrete needs clearned and removed as you promised.-Still waiting on door stops to be installed throughout the house. I have provided you requested info so you could order and have stops installed.-Missing door handle on office doors. Three of four were installed.-Missing trim in master bath linen closet/wall -Safe room top deadbolt needs adjusted so deadbolt will engage and lock....it was mismatched from beginning.-Stair railing which was painted rather than stained still waiting to be swapped out. It should have never been painted and been stained to match steps.-Washed out dirt on new water line especially at water meter needs filled.-Exposed water valve in guest room closet still needs covered/closed -Missing shoe mold in closet.I just want to get the final items completed.

      Business Response

      Date: 07/31/2023

      Firstly, I want to state that I have responded to most of the correspondence from ************. I have emails that I will upload as an attachment to verify that. Secondly, I received the certificate of occupancy on Jan 20, 2023. We did not receive the "punch list" until April 27, 2023. Thats over 3 months after the ** and approximately 5 months after ************ moved into the residence. We have been working with ************ to get the items complete. As the evidence of the emails shows, a substantial amount of the "punch list" has been completed from date to date that was stated I would not respond. To say that I have avoided or been unresponsive is absolutely untrue. As shown in the emails to again verify. I have emailed the vendors and subcontractors the lists of items directly and a majority of the companies have scheduled repairs directly with ************ and those items have been completed. I will continue to work to complete the items that are desired on the list. As of today I have called or text the remaining vendors to notify them of the items still left to do.
